Gross portfolio equity assets to GDP in Liberia
Liberia: Gross portfolio equity assets to GDP was 98.0% in 2016. ▼ Falling
Gross portfolio equity assets to GDP in Liberia, 2009–2016
Source: International Financial Statistics (IFS), International Monetary Fund (IMF). Measured in %.
Analysis
The most recent figure for gross portfolio equity assets to gdp in Liberia is 98.0%, measured in 2016.
The figure is up 5.7% on the previous year and down 41.4% over ten years.
Liberia ranks 12th of 131 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

About this data
Ratio of gross portfolio equity assets to GDP. Equity assets include shares, stocks, participation, and similar documents (such as American depository receipts) that usually denote ownership of equity. Raw data are from the electronic version of the IMF's International Financial Statistics. IFS line 79ADDZF / GDP. Local currency GDP is from IFS (line 99B..ZF or, if not available, line 99B.CZF).
